Whats Next A Swarm of Locusts?

Maybe, but not Here …
-by Peter Francese
Just when it was starting to look like there was a hint of stability in housing prices – WHAM! – Wall Street firms start crashing. Who knew they lived so close to the edge?
The psychological and perhaps economic impact on consumers, many with heavy 401-K exposure, can only be bad.

Here in little old New Hampshire, far from the perils of Wall Street, things don’t look so bad.
